At 11:29 AM -0800 12/19/03, Toru . wrote:
>how long it takes to complete "make install clean" of
>cvsup-without-gui. It looks like the process went into
>a infinate loop and I keep seeing the same message over
>and over. Is this normal behavior?

It is hard to know for sure, because you didn't really
give us much information -- such as *what* message you
are seeing over and over again.

If you do not have a modula-3 compiler installed (and
you probably do not, if this is a new install), then
it will take a long time to build cvsup-without-gui,
because you first have to build the modula-3 compiler.
